Mikuni "sub throttle valve" fuel injection system is based on the FZ1 design, featuring 35mm throttle bodies fitted with T.P.S. (Throttle Position Sensor). This style of fuel injection uses sub throttle valves in addition to the main valves to further control the intake airflow. The sub valves optimize the intake volumetric efficiency at all rpms and are powered by a stepping motor that is controlled by the ECU. The key benefit is excellent "ride ability" and throttle response.
The injectors are sequential high dynamic range type featuring 4 holes and a dual directional spray pattern for excellent power and a linear throttle response across the entire rev range. The fuel injections lightweight Electronic Control Unit (ECU) utilizes a powerful 32-bit processor for fast control of the injection process. The compact design also reduces weight.
Specially designed 7.8 litre airbox features different intake funnel lengths for the inner (150mm) and outer (125mm) cylinders. The benefit is a wide torque curve. A high flow paper type air filter is utilized.
R1 inspired "stacked" 3-axis gearbox / clutch design stacks input/output shafts to centralize mass and keeps overall engine size shorter front to back. As a result, the stacked design gives the engineers the freedom to place the engine in the frame for optimum front to rear weight balance and thereby maximizing handling performance.
Smooth shifting wide ratio 6-speed transmission features optimized gear ratios for maximum performance in the "real world". 5th and 6th ratios are "tall" for reduced engine rpms at highway speeds for excellent rider comfort.
Compact, heavy duty, multi-plate clutch ensures consistent, positive engagement. The clutch has been designed to provide a light lever pull for excellent rider comfort … especially during stop and go city use.
4 into 2 into 1 exhaust system features 35mm diameter, stainless steel header pipes and a short design silencer / muffler. The header pipe length has been optimized for maximum power and torque. This system is fitted with a 3-way honeycomb catalyzer with an oxygen sensor to reduce harmful CO and HC exhaust emissions. The oxygen sensor monitors the amount of oxygen in the spent gases and adjusts the fuel -air mixture via the ECU and FI system for maximum performance with minimum emissions.
High-efficiency "curved" design radiator features compact dual ring-type fans for maximum cooling efficiency. This rad and fan design allows more airflow than conventional flat design rads to maintain optimum engine temperatures for consistent power output. Large liquid-cooled oil cooler maintains stable lubricant temperatures for extended engine life.

2012 Yamaha Fazer 8 - Canadian Specifications/Technical Details
Canada MSRP Price: See dealer for pricing in CDN



Engine
  • Engine Liquid-cooled, DOHC, 16-valve, inline 4
  • Displacement 779cc 
  • Bore and Stroke 68 x 53.6mm 
  • Compression Ratio 12:1 
  • Maximum Torque 8.4 kg-m (60.8 ft-lbs.) @ 8,000 rpm 
  • Fuel Delivery Mikuni 35mm throttle body F.I 
  • Estimated Fuel Consumption* 16kpl / 45.5mpg (Imp) 
  • Lubrication Wet sump 
  • Ignition / Starting TCI / Electric 
  • Transmission 6-speed 
  • Final Drive "O"-ring chain
Chassis
  • Suspension (Front) 43mm inverted fork
  • Suspension (Rear) Link Monocross 
  • Brakes (Front) Dual 310mm disc 
  • Brakes (Rear) 267mm disc 
  • Tires (Front) 120/70ZR17 
  • Tires (Rear) 180/55ZR17
Dimensions / Technical Details
  • Length 2,140mm (84.3")
  • Width 770mm (30.3") 
  • Height 1,225mm (48.2") 
  • Wheelbase 1,460mm (57.5") 
  • Rake / Trail 25° / 109mm 
  • Seat Height 815mm (32.1") 
  • Fuel Capacity 17 litres (3.7 Imp. gal.) 
  • Wet Weight 216kg (476 lbs) 
  • Colour(s) Metallic Black

2012 Yamaha Fazer 8 - European Specifications/Technical Details
European MSRP Price: See dealer for pricing.



Engine
  • Engine type liquid-cooled, 4-stroke, DOHC, forward-inclined parallel 4-cylinder
  • Displacement 779cc 
  • Bore x stroke 68.0 mm x 53.6 mm 
  • Compression ratio 12.0 : 1 
  • Maximum Power 78.1 kW (106.2PS) @ 10,000 rpm 
  • Maximum Torque 82.0 Nm (8.4 kg-m) @ 8,000 rpm 
  • Lubrication system Wet sump 
  • Carburettor Electronic Fuel Injection 
  • Clutch Type Wet, multiple-disc coil spring 
  • Ignition system Transistorized coil ignition 
  • Starter system Electric 
  • Transmission system Constant Mesh, 6-speed 
  • Final transmission Chain
Chassis
  • Frame Diamond
  • Front suspension system Upside-down telescopic fork, Ø 43 mm inner tube 
  • Front travel 130 mm 
  • Caster Angle 25º 
  • Trail 109 mm 
  • Rear suspension system Swingarm, Linked monoshock with spring preload adjustment 
  • Rear Travel 130 mm 
  • Front brake Hydraulic dual disc, Ø 310 mm 
  • Rear brake Hydraulic single disc, Ø 267 mm 
  • Front tyre 120/70 ZR17M/C (58W) 
  • Rear tyre 180/55 ZR17M/C (73W)
Dimensions
  • Overall length 2,140 mm
  • Overall width 770 mm 
  • Overall height 1,225 mm 
  • Seat height 815 mm 
  • Wheel base 1,460 mm 
  • Minimum ground clearance 140 mm 
  • Wet weight (including full oil and fuel tank) 215 kg / ABS 220 kg 
  • Fuel tank capacity 17 litres 
  • Oil tank capacity 3.8 litres
